Motion .carried. • PUBLIC HEARING, CITY OF LAKEVILLE, to consider the amending of Ordinance 42, by adding to Section 25.8 (2) f, as follows; pne and two-family dwelling units here- . ina,fter erected shall be so located that at least a two (2) car garage, either attached or detached, can be located on the lot in conformance with the setback requirement. At the time a building permit is requested, the applicant sha1.1 submit a site plan which indicates the dimensions and location of a two-car garage. Motion carried, with Spande, Hazel, Antolik, Lutgens, Campbell,' and. Jojade voting f~aye~~. A discussion and examination of Dave Goodermont~s proposal for fence ordinance amendment was begun. Comments were generally good. Campbell, Lutgens, and Jojade were concerned with repair and maintenance, .Hazel asked about the industrial fence. He was told that the barbed wire, if fence were to be topped, would be within the lot line, Hazel. wished to know what happens to fences that already exist but do not meet ordinance requirements. R. Knutson :replied that they are either (1) grandfathered in, or (2) more difficult, asystem of :.amortization can be used. • Roger Knutson was asked to work on the ordinance and bring it in suggested form next meeting.
